Destiny 2’s PC beta begins today – includes campaign, crucible, and strike activities

The PC beta for Destiny 2 will begin very soon for those who have pre-ordered the game. The preload started this past Friday, August 25, with the beta officially kicking off today at 10:00 PDT / 13:00 EDT / 18:00 BST for pre-orders. The start time for anyone who hasn’t pre-ordered the game is tomorrow, August 29, at 10:00 PDT / 13:00 EDT / 18:00 BST. It will last through August 31, ending at 10:00 PDT / 13:00 EDT / 18:00 BST.

There are a variety of activities in the beta. Players will be able to customise their guardian and engage in the first campaign mission titled Homecoming. Access to two game types in Crucible is also included, called “Countdown” and “Control,” each on a unique map.

Lastly is “The Inverted Spire,” a strike activity with a fireteam on the new planet Nessus.
